    Picking the Perfect Construction Material

    Choosing the ideal material for your fence is a vital first step in your professional fence installation journey. You'll need to evaluate wood vs vinyl, metal vs composite, considering each's maintenance needs, cost, and longevity. Wood is a timeless selection, offering a warm, natural aesthetic. However, it does need consistent upkeep to stop decay. Vinyl, alternatively, is a contemporary option requiring minimal maintenance but could lack the same traditional beauty. Metal fences, specifically steel or aluminum, offer robust security. They're durable but tend to be more expensive. Composite materials, a mixture of wood and plastic, offer the ideal combination when it comes to aesthetics and durability. Select thoughtfully; your decision affects not just your property's look, but its future care.

    An In-Depth Look at Various Fencing Material Choices

    In the process of deciding on fencing, multiple elements affect the ultimate decision. Knowing the pros and cons of diverse fencing solutions is crucial for installing a fence professionally in Utah. Traditional wood fences offer traditional appeal and seclusion, but demand consistent care. Vinyl options shine with low upkeep needs and various design choices, though they require a larger investment. Wire fencing provides budget-friendly solutions and unobstructed views, but offers minimal privacy. Metal options distinguish themselves in durability and security, despite being less decorative. Mixed material options combine the advantages of traditional and modern elements, providing enduring aesthetics, but requiring greater investment. For decorative appeal, look into ornamental styles, while recognizing privacy constraints.

    Standard Housekeeping Procedures

    While it may seem like a hassle, routine fence cleaning is remarkably simple and can substantially lengthen its lifespan. How often you clean is determined by your fence material and environmental factors. More often than not, a bi-annual cleaning is sufficient. Opt for eco-friendly cleaning solutions to protect the surface. For wooden fences, a solution of gentle detergent and warm water works effectively, while vinyl fencing respond well to vinegar mixtures. Use gentle scrubbing motions to prevent paint damage. Remember, your fence isn't just a boundary - it's a valuable asset. Consistent upkeep is vital for long-term protection. Your fence will repay you with extended durability.

    Appropriate Repair Strategies

    Proper maintenance and repair work enhance the lifespan of your fence. Being familiar with common issues and fixing approaches is important. When you find cracks, these can be fixed with top-grade wood filler, while loose boards click here typically need fastening. Significant damage like rot require full replacement of damaged sections. Don't ignore minor damage, as they can grow rapidly, threatening your fence's structural integrity. Regular observation and prompt action are vital. With correct information and approach, your fence will maintain strength and beautiful for the long term. Keep in mind that a well-maintained fence not only appears better but also serves you longer.

    What's the Typical Timeframe for an Expert Fence Build?

    Are you curious about the usual installation timeline for a professional fence? Typically, installation takes 1-3 days, though several considerations including the overall length and material type will determine the installation period.
